Understanding Propylene Glycol Engine Coolant Benefits and Applications
Propylene glycol engine coolant is becoming increasingly popular in various automotive and industrial applications due to its unique properties and safety profile. As a synthetic organic compound, propylene glycol is derived from petroleum products but is non-toxic and environmentally friendly, making it a preferred choice in many applications where traditional ethylene glycol coolants might pose health risks or environmental concerns.
One of the most significant advantages of propylene glycol engine coolant is its safety. Unlike ethylene glycol, which is toxic and can pose serious health risks if ingested, propylene glycol has been determined to be generally recognized as safe (GRAS) by the United States Food and Drug Administration (FDA). This makes it an ideal coolant for vehicles that may be used in settings where there is a risk of accidental ingestion, such as in food processing plants, or in systems where people or pets are present.
In addition to its safety, propylene glycol coolant offers excellent thermal properties. It has a lower freezing point and a higher boiling point than water, allowing it to perform effectively across a wide range of temperatures. This property ensures that the engine operates within the optimal temperature range, preventing overheating in high-heat situations and freezing in colder climates. It can generally be mixed with water to create an efficient antifreeze solution, enhancing performance further.
Another noteworthy benefit of propylene glycol engine coolant is its ability to inhibit corrosion. It contains additives that prevent rust and scale formation within the cooling system, thereby extending the life of the engine and its components. This is particularly crucial for modern engines that feature a variety of metals and alloys, all of which can be susceptible to damage from corrosion if not properly protected.
When it comes to environmental considerations, propylene glycol is biodegradable, which means that it breaks down naturally over time and poses minimal risk to soil and water resources. This aspect is increasingly important, given the growing concerns about the ecological impact of various substances used in automotive applications.
While propylene glycol engine coolant may have a higher initial cost compared to traditional coolants, the long-term benefits it offers, such as reduced maintenance costs and increased safety, make it a worthy investment. Moreover, its compatibility with various cooling systems allows it to be utilized in a variety of vehicles, including passenger cars, trucks, and heavy machinery.
In conclusion, propylene glycol engine coolant presents a compelling option for those looking for a safe, effective, and environmentally friendly cooling solution. Its thermal stability, corrosion resistance, and biodegradability make it an excellent choice in today's automotive and industrial landscapes. As manufacturers increasingly prioritize safety and sustainability, the use of propylene glycol as an engine coolant is likely to expand even further in the years to come.
